Security and Privacy in the Industrial Internet of Things: Current Standards and Future Challenges

Abstract: The Internet of Things (IoT) is rapidly becoming an integral component of the industrial market in areas such as automation and analytics, giving rise to what is termed as the Industrial IoT (IIoT). The IIoT promises innovative business models in various industrial domains by providing ubiquitous connectivity, efficient data analytics tools, and better decision support systems for a better market competitiveness.
